Belleville man charged with attempted robbery

  • March 8, 2016 at 2:46 pm

By Deanna Fraser

BELLEVILLE – A 35-year-old man is facing charges after he attempted to rob a downtown bank with a knife on Monday afternoon.

Police say the man walked into a bank on Front Street around 2:30 p.m., pulled out a knife, and demanded money from a teller.

The man left the location empty-handed.

Belleville Police arrested him a short time later at the intersection of Front Street and Bridge Street.

He was charged with breach of probation and attempted robbery.

He was held for a bail hearing on Tuesday.

No injuries were reported.
